Understanding the Freelancing Landscape

The Rise of Freelancing in the Modern Economy

Freelancing keeps growing worldwide. Last estimates show over 35% of workers do freelance work today. In some regions, it’s even more common. The internet has made it easy for anyone to find gigs. You no longer need a big company or office. All you need is a device and an internet connection. Many newbies start by offering simple skills online.

Common Myths About Zero-Investment Freelancing

Some believe you need fancy tools or certificates to succeed. That’s not true. You can start with free resources and basic skills. Many freelancers in early days used free trial tools or borrowed equipment. The key is to begin with what you have, then improve over time. Success hinges more on effort and skill than on spending money.

Skills in High Demand for Freelancers

Certain skills are super popular right now: content writing, graphic design, social media marketing, virtual assistance, and translation. Pick what suits you best. Think about your hobbies, past work, or passions. Practice to sharpen those skills. This makes it easier to attract clients and secure gigs.

Setting Up Your Freelance Profile Without Investment

Utilizing Free Online Platforms

Start with free websites like Upwork, Fiverr, Freelancer, or PeoplePerHour. These platforms connect clients and freelancers globally. Choose ones that match your skill set. Creating a profile is free, and you can upload samples or portfolios without paying. Craft a catchy headline and description to stand out.

Crafting an Effective Service Offer

Define clear, niche-specific services. Instead of vague titles like “writer,” try “blog post writer focusing on tech topics.” Write gig descriptions that explain what you do, how you do it, and what clients will get. Use keywords people search for. This boosts your chances of appearing in search results.

Building a Professional Online Presence for Free

Use social media accounts to showcase your work. LinkedIn is perfect for professional networking. Instagram or Twitter help reach a broader audience. You can also create a free online portfolio using platforms like Wix or WordPress. Keep your profiles consistent, clean, and updated.

Enhancing Skills and Gaining Experience for Free

Free Learning Resources and Courses

Improve your skills by using free courses on Coursera, Udemy, YouTube, and Skillshare. Watch tutorials and read blogs to stay current. Learning new tricks makes you more competitive. Dedicate time daily for skill growth.

Volunteer Projects and Pro Bono Work

Offer your services free or at a discount to friends, family, or nonprofits. This builds your portfolio and boosts confidence. When you complete projects successfully, ask clients for feedback and share results with others. It’s a win-win to get real-world experience.

Networking Without Spending

Join free online groups related to your niche. Facebook groups, Reddit forums, or LinkedIn communities are good options. Attend free webinars and virtual events to learn and network. These connections often lead to first gigs or referrals.

Finding and Landing Your First Freelance Clients

Strategies for Free Client Acquisition

Start by reaching out to contacts you already know. Friends, coworkers, or family might need your help. Use community boards or free platforms to find jobs. Post in social media groups to get noticed. Be active and consistent.

Crafting Winning Proposals and Pitches

Personalize each proposal. Address the client by name and mention their project specifics. Keep it short, clear, and result-focused. Show how you can help solve their problem. Avoid generic messages that get ignored.

Building Long-Term Client Relationships

Give clients your best work every time. Communicate well and respect deadlines. Happy clients leave reviews and refer others to you. Don’t ask for too much, but politely request feedback after successful projects.

Scaling Your Freelance Business Zero Cost

Managing Projects and Time Effectively

Use free tools like Trello, Asana, or Google Keep to stay organized. These platforms help track tasks and deadlines. Set daily routines to balance multiple gigs and avoid burnout.

Upskilling for Higher-Paying Gigs

Look for free advanced courses on your skills. Learn new techniques or tools that add value. As your skills grow, you can take bigger, higher-paying projects. Diversify your services to stay competitive.

Creating Passive Income Streams

Repurpose your content into ebooks, templates, or courses. Platforms like YouTube or TikTok let you share ideas and earn revenue. Use free tools to create simple digital products that keep making money over time.
